Quick Answer

The answer is AWS CloudTrail with CloudWatch alarms. This is correct because CloudTrail captures every S3 API call, including `AccessDenied` errors when an IAM user attempts to access a bucket without proper permissions, and CloudWatch Alarms can monitor those specific log events to trigger real-time unauthorized S3 access alerts. On the AWS Certified Security Specialty SCS-C02 exam, this scenario tests your understanding of detective controls and the integration between CloudTrail and CloudWatch for security monitoring—a common trap is choosing S3 server access logs, which are not real-time and lack the granular API-level detail of CloudTrail. Remember that CloudTrail logs the *who*, *what*, and *when* of every denied attempt, while CloudWatch Alarms provides the *alert*. A company's security team wants to detect unauthorized S3 bucket access attempts in real time. Which service should they use to generate alerts when an IAM user attempts to access a bucket without proper permissions?

Correct answer & explanation

AWS CloudTrail with CloudWatch alarms

AWS CloudTrail logs all API calls made to S3, including access denied errors. By creating a CloudWatch alarm on the `S3 AccessDenied` event in CloudTrail logs, the security team can receive real-time alerts when an IAM user attempts to access a bucket without proper permissions. This approach directly captures the unauthorized attempt at the API level, enabling immediate detection.

Detailed technical explanation

How to think about this question

CloudTrail delivers events to CloudWatch Logs in near real-time (typically within 15 minutes), and a CloudWatch alarm can be configured to trigger on a metric filter that matches the `AccessDenied` error code in the `errorCode` field of the CloudTrail log entry. This setup allows the security team to receive SNS notifications or trigger Lambda functions for immediate response. A subtle behavior is that CloudTrail must be enabled for S3 data events (not just management events) to capture object-level access attempts, which is a common oversight.
